Outline (in English)

"Course outline and Learning Objectives"
The earth has 8.7 million species of plant and animal, including unknown creatures, according to a one of the studies. Those organisms affect the environment on various scales, and the environment affects organisms. Ecology is one of the natural sciences which studies the interactions among organisms and their environment. In this lecture, all students can learn the basic knowledge and concept of ecology, cultivate ecological knowledge and skills to elucidate and solve various problems and phenomena occurring in the natural environment.
